<p>The <strong>Pin Parvati Pass Trek</strong> is one of the most remote, challenging, and breathtaking treks in the entire Indian Himalaya. This 11-day crossing begins in the lush, forested <strong>Parvati Valley</strong> of Kullu district and ends in the stark, lunar landscape of <strong>Spiti Valley's Pin Valley National Park</strong> — a complete transformation of terrain, culture, and climate over 90+ kilometres of trail.</p><p>The <strong>Pin Parvati Pass</strong> stands at <strong>5,319 metres (17,457 ft)</strong> — higher than most European peaks — and is only reliably accessible for <strong>10 weeks per year</strong> (July to September) when the glacier approach is stable. The pass sits on the boundary of the Kullu and Lahaul-Spiti districts and requires careful navigation, glacier crossing experience, and absolute fitness. This is not a trek for beginners.</p><p>The approach from the Parvati Valley side is one of the most beautiful in Himachal: starting at the famous hot springs and meadow of <strong>Kheerganga</strong>, the trail climbs through increasingly remote terrain past <strong>Tunda Bhuj</strong>, <strong>Thakur Kuan</strong>, and the remote Hindu pilgrimage site of <strong>Mantalai Lake</strong> (4,116m) — believed to be a sacred lake of Lord Shiva. Above Mantalai, the trail enters permanent glacier and snowfield territory, demanding technical awareness but no roped climbing.</p><p>The descent into <strong>Pin Valley</strong> is dramatic — a stark, nearly vertical landscape of grey scree and silver glacial streams. The Pin Valley National Park is one of the last habitats of the <strong>snow leopard</strong> in India, and sightings, while rare, are possible. Villages like <strong>Mudh</strong> in Pin Valley are among the most isolated in Himachal Pradesh, accessible only via this trek or a long dirt road from Kaza.</p><p>Junegiri Yatra provides the full logistics team: experienced guide with Pin Parvati experience, cook, porter (for shared equipment), camping gear, and all meals.
